Crates is a privacy-focused music collection manager with a local-first architecture. It imports playlists and libraries from YouTube, Spotify, Apple Music, and SoundCloud while keeping all data stored on the user's device. A free Community tier provides core features; a paid Supporter tier unlocks mobile access, advanced discovery, and early-access features.

S10.AI is an ambient AI platform for healthcare that layers over existing EHRs via FHIR, HL7, and clinical RPA bots. Its four-module suite — CRUSH for real-time clinical documentation, BRAVO for 24/7 multilingual voice handling, SHINE for HCC revenue capture and denial management, and a custom AI agent builder — targets practices seeking to reduce clinician burnout, capture risk-adjusted revenue, and automate patient communication without replacing their current systems. The vendor reports deployment in under a week and publishes a case study of a DPC startup reaching break-even by month four without administrative staff.
